发明名称 ABRASIVE MATERIAL AND METHOD FOR ELECTROPHORESIS ABRASION
摘要 PROBLEM TO BE SOLVED: To not only enlarge the diameter of a diamond abrasive grains stuck to a negative electrode by electrophoresis to a mush larger size than those of the existing ones and to thicken the thickness thereof by a large margin but also to satisfactory abrase an abrased object made of a conductive material and cause to become a negative electrode, with regard to an abrasive material and a method applied to electrophoresis abrasion using an electrophoresis phenomenon. SOLUTION: An abrasive material for electrophoresis abrasion is made by mixing diamond abrasive grains 23 and aluminum oxide particulates 25 with water. An electrophoresis abrasion method is to abrase an abrased object with an abrasing tool 29 stuck with diamond abrasive grains 23 as well as aluminum oxide particulates 25 by dipping the abrasing tool 29, which is caused to become a negative electrode, and a positive electrode 27 into an abrasive material for electrophoresis abrasion and impressing voltage to the abrasing tool 29 and the positive electrode 27, sticking diamond abrasive grain 23 as well as aluminum oxide particulates on the abrasive fool 29.
